I was fooling around with the OF (as usual) to try to make the AI play better, and guess what... I found it!!!!
I activated "Passer" card on every single player in the OF, and Box to Box on all "CMF" to make the holes between defence and attack smaller. I also activated "Pinpoint Pass" for all "CMF" wich resulted in more long passes, but not too much really. Now suddenly the AI seems to know what it wants to do with the ball, but the ping pong effect is very little, if any at all... depends on the team really. Now with these cards activated, even crappy players does something sensible with the ball, the biggest difference is that they fail to do what they're trying to do. One of the biggest gripes with orignial PES2010 OF is that AI doesen't seem to have a clue what to do next 90% of the time, but they defend like maniacs.
I know this edit will take ages for you console dudes, but I urge you to back up your OF, add these edits to two teams and watch them play in spectator mode and enjoy.
